网页运行始于浏览器向服务器发起请求,服务器返回HTML等资源,浏览器解析并渲染页面;HTML是超文本标记语言,用于定义网页结构,通过标签构建内容骨架,是网页运行的基础。

网页的运行依赖于浏览器、服务器和一系列技术标准的协作,其中HTML是构建网页内容的核心语言。要理解网页是怎么运行的,以及HTML是什么,需要从用户访问网页的过程说起。
网页是怎么运行的
当你在浏览器中输入一个网址(如 https://www.example.com)时,背后发生了一系列步骤:
- 浏览器向该网址对应的服务器发起请求,这个过程通过HTTP或HTTPS协议完成。
- 服务器接收到请求后,查找并返回相应的文件,通常是HTML文件,也可能包括CSS、JavaScript、图片等资源。
- 浏览器接收到HTML文件后,开始解析它,并根据其中的内容构建网页的结构。
- 在解析过程中,如果发现还需要加载CSS样式或JavaScript脚本,浏览器会再次向服务器请求这些资源。
- 所有资源加载完成后,浏览器将内容渲染成可视化的页面,用户就能看到完整的网页了。
整个过程在几秒甚至更短时间内完成,用户通常察觉不到背后的复杂交互。
HTML是什么
HTML 全称是 HyperText Markup Language,即超文本标记语言。它不是编程语言,而是一种用于描述网页结构的标记语言。
立即学习“前端免费学习笔记(深入)”;
- HTML使用“标签”来定义网页中的不同元素,比如标题、段落、图片、链接等。
- 一个基本的HTML文档包含 html>、 和 等标签。
- 例如:
这是一个标题
会在页面上显示一个一级标题。 - 浏览器读取这些标签后,就知道如何展示内容,但标签本身不会直接显示在页面上。
HTML的作用是搭建网页的“骨架”,而CSS负责美化外观,JavaScript则让网页具备交互功能。
HTML与网页运行的关系
HTML是网页运行的基础。没有HTML,浏览器就无法知道要显示什么内容。
- 服务器返回的首要文件通常是HTML,它是整个页面的起点。
- 浏览器必须先解析HTML,才能知道后续需要加载哪些资源。
- 即使网页看起来非常复杂,其本质仍然是由HTML组织内容结构。
可以说,HTML就像房子的框架,决定了网页的布局和内容顺序,其他技术在此基础上进行装饰和功能扩展。
基本上就这些。理解网页运行机制和HTML的基本概念,有助于更好地认识我们每天使用的互联网世界。不复杂,但容易忽略细节。











